A casino’s legal framework matters more than its colour scheme. Reputable operators normally identify the company behind the website, the regulator overseeing its activity, and the jurisdictions in which accounts may be opened. If these details are hidden behind vague wording, treat that as a warning rather than an invitation to investigate further with your wallet.
Licensing does not guarantee that every customer experience will be flawless. It does, however, provide a route for complaints, sets minimum standards for player protection, and places obligations on operators handling funds and personal data. Look for verification information at the bottom of the website and confirm it through the regulator’s own register where possible.
Promotional offers are rarely as simple as “deposit and receive.” A bonus may require a qualifying payment method, a minimum deposit, selected games, or completion within a short period. The headline amount is only one part of the calculation; wagering requirements, contribution rates, and maximum bet rules can change the practical value considerably.
| Term | What to check | Why it matters |
|---|---|---|
| Wagering requirement | Multiplier applied to the bonus, deposit, or both | Shows how much qualifying play is required |
| Game contribution | Whether slots, table games, and live games count equally | Affects the speed and cost of meeting the terms |
| Maximum bet | Stake limit while bonus funds are active | A breach may void winnings |
| Expiry period | Deadline for completing the promotion | Unused funds may disappear automatically |
| Withdrawal cap | Limit applied to promotional winnings | Can reduce the amount available for withdrawal |
Consider a fictional £100 bonus with a 35x wagering requirement applied to the bonus alone. That means £3,500 in qualifying wagers, not a casual spin or two while waiting for the kettle. If the requirement applies to deposit and bonus, the figure rises to £7,000. Calculating this before accepting the offer is less glamorous than chasing a prize, but substantially more useful.
Payment pages deserve the same scrutiny as game lobbies. Check the available deposit and withdrawal methods, minimum and maximum limits, processing times, and any fees. A casino may accept a card instantly yet take several business days to process a withdrawal, particularly when an account review is required.
Identity verification is normal in regulated gambling. Operators may request proof of identity, address, payment ownership, or source of funds. That can feel inconvenient, especially after a profitable session, but an operator that never asks questions may be ignoring important legal duties. The sensible approach is to submit documents only through secure account channels and avoid sending sensitive files through random email addresses.
Random number generators should be tested by approved independent laboratories, while live casino tables should identify the studio and provide clear rules. These details do not transform probability into a personal favour. A slot remains a mathematical product, and a losing streak is not evidence that the next spin is “due.” Machines do not have moods, despite the persuasive mythology surrounding them.
Responsible play works best when it is practical rather than theatrical. Set a deposit limit before gambling, decide how long a session may last, and keep gambling money separate from household spending. A player who treats a casino balance as entertainment expenditure is less vulnerable to the classic temptation of trying to win back losses before bedtime.
Useful controls commonly include deposit limits, loss limits, session reminders, temporary account breaks, and permanent self-exclusion. Test these tools when calm, not only after an unlucky run. If gambling has begun affecting finances, sleep, relationships, or work, stopping altogether and seeking specialist support is the appropriate response.
